If you're really serious about that you'd better prepare your shores and pick your piece of land and buy it now. I happen to have a house in 'the province' and have adapted to living & working there, but prices of land are on the rise, and not just a little bit. Plots of land in remote areas once costing 2000 USD (let's say 3 years ago) now cost double or more. Plots of land inside the provincial centers already have crazy prices. A piece of land in central Ban Lung about 600 m from the market (where? Yes, there, on the edge of civilization) measuring 20 x 55 x 24 meters sold for well over 150k USD about 14 days ago, and it had been for sale for only two weeks if I remember well. Of course it's just a piece of land without any amenities like water, electricity, a well etc.... Many pieces of land in Cambodia aren't rectangular for all sorts of reasons. The front (roadside) of this specific plot measures 20 meters, it's 55 m deep (or so they say), and at the back it measures 24 M. The asking price was 190k by the way, or 157 USD per M2.Khmerhamster wrote:I don't understand.Kachang wrote: A piece of land in central Ban Lung about 600 m from the market (where?
